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Leighton Buzzard to Thornton Heath start from £15.50 one way, or £31.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Leighton Buzzard to Thornton Heath are available for £23.80 one way, or £47.60 return

Facilities at Leighton Buzzard Station

The station is equipped to cater to a wide range of passenger needs. Offering ample ticket purchasing options, the ticket office operates during convenient hours throughout the week. For early risers or late-night planners, ticket machines are available, as well as accessible machines for passengers with additional needs. True to its commitment to accessibility, Leighton Buzzard station also features an induction loop and several accessible amenities, including step-free access and assistance meeting points. While there is no waiting room, there are seating areas where passengers can relax before their next departure.

Onward Travel Options

Traveling beyond Leighton Buzzard is a breeze with the transport links available at the station. For those requiring alternative modes of transportation, taxi services are readily accessible with a taxi free phone available at the station. Should there be any rail service disruptions, rail replacement vehicles provide continued connectivity and are stationed at the front of the station. If you prefer local buses, all essential planning information is available online in a printable format to ease your journey planning.

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Thornton Heath Station is equipped with a wide range of facilities to ensure a convenient travel experience. The ticket office has generous opening hours throughout the week, with mornings starting as early as 6:15 AM on weekdays. Ticket machines are available, accommodating transactions, including those requiring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. An induction loop system is in place for those needing hearing assistance. While step-free access ensures easy navigation throughout the station, it's worthy to note that wheelchairs are not available on-site.

Help and Support

For those needing assistance, staff is available from early morning until well past midnight. Help Points around the station offer easy access to assistance, whether you need help boarding a train or navigating around the station. It's always reassuring to know that direct support is on hand should you need it. There is, however, no luggage storage, so plan accordingly if you're carrying baggage.

Transport Connections

Whether you're looking to explore the local area or continue your journey beyond, Thornton Heath offers several travel connections. Buses and rail replacement services are accessible, with comprehensive travel information available onsite to help you plot the next stage of your journey. Unfortunately, there are no cycling facilities, so cycling enthusiasts will need to look elsewhere for bicycle storage or hire.
